What might 24 MALVERN DRIVE be worth now?

24 MALVERN DRIVE might now be worth an estimated £344,029.

This is based on house price inflation of 6.4%, between August 2022 and February 2025, for semi-detached houses, in the Walsall local authority area, as calculated by the Office for National Statistics and published in their UK House Price Index (HPI).

The 6.4% inflationary increase is applied to the most recent sale price for 24 MALVERN DRIVE of £323,250 on 26th August 2022. For the value to have increased from £323,250 to £344,029 over the three years and six months to February 2025, the following assumptions must hold true:

  • The value of 24 MALVERN DRIVE has moved in line with the HPI for semi-detached houses in the Walsall local authority area.
  • The August 2022 sale price of £323,250 represented a fair market value for the property.
  • The size, condition, and specification of 24 MALVERN DRIVE has not materially changed since August 2022.
